我如何在React中隐藏我的Api_key,这样我就可以安全地将它推送到GitHub,我还想在我的GitHub上托管它,这样其他人就可以使用该网站了!帮助
使用.env
文件存储api密钥,并使用.gitignore
文件将其从github提交中删除。
例如,您有一个名为.env
的文件,其中包含以下内容
KEY={INSERTKEYHERE}
然后制作具有以下内容的.gitignore
.env
环境变量可以作为在代码中引用
{process.env.KEY}